Orsolya Szilágyi ( Hungarian: Szilágyi Orsolya) was a Hungarian noblewoman from the House of Szilágyi, she was the daughter of count László (Ladislaus) Szilágyi and Katalin Bellyéni. [1] Orsolya Szilágyi was the wife of John Rozgonyi, which was voivode of Transylvania between 1441–1458 and between 1459–1461 (for the second time), [2] also ispán of Sopron and Vas Counties (1449–1454), count of the Székelys (1457–1458). [3] [4] They had the following children: John, András, István, Apollónia (who married Benedek Csáky). [5]
